Combine Groups
You can combine multiple groups into a single group when you need to merge participant lists. This is useful when consolidating data from different sources or cleaning up duplicate lists.
When to Combine Groups
Use the combine action when:
- You have multiple groups that should be one
- You imported data into separate groups and want to merge them
- You are cleaning up duplicate or overlapping lists
Combine Groups
- Go to the Groups page
- Select two or more groups
- Click Combine
- Enter a name for the new group
- Confirm the action
A new group will be created containing the combined data.
What Happens When You Combine Groups
- All people from the selected groups are included
- All fields from each group are preserved
- If duplicate fields exist, one value is retained
The original groups remain unchanged unless you choose to remove them afterward.
Important Notes
- You can only combine groups with other groups
- Subgroups are not merged directly across different main groups
- To combine subgroups from different sources, combine their main groups first
Tips for Combining Groups
- Review field names before combining to avoid duplicates
- Export groups as a backup before merging
- Clean up old groups after confirming the new combined group
